About Gray County

Gray County, anchored by the city of Pampa, is a Texas Panhandle producing county with active Cleveland Sand, Granite Wash, and Tonkawa development alongside legacy oil and gas production dating to the 1920s. The county has a long operator history and supports both modern horizontal and vertical-era production.

Cities and communities: Pampa, McLean, Lefors.

What This Means for Mineral Owners

Pampa-area mineral interests often combine legacy 1920s–1930s leases with modern horizontal pooling and unitization.
